  1. Don't forget municipal and regional airports. Lots of Clark tugs, and towed auxiliary ground support equipment had Chrysler flatheads. Also forklifts, welders and compressors, older bombardier snow cats, some can be found in sidewalk plows cities used. Irrigation pumps, for agriculture and maybe even golf courses. And speaking of golf courses, groundskeeping equipment, college campuses too.

  3. The best thing you can do for your engines performance is to boost the compression ratio. This assumes the rest of the engine is in good working order. .030 to .050 milled from the cylinder head will put your compression ratio up a point and a half or so. With this change you can also advance the timing a few degrees for better throttle response. You can also open up the intake and exhaust ports to match the gasket hole sizes. The 201 is never going to be a neck snapper, but it can be made more lively through these inexpensive modifications.   7. Yes the design is tapered. It primary function is to direct coolant up from the slots on top to the area under the valve seats. The shape and size of the slots assures equal flow to all the areas around the seats.
  8. You will want to get new rubber mounts for the engine, new gaskets, and seals,, new pistons, rings. Rods can be reused if not in bad shape. New crank and rod bearings especially if they require machining.New timing gears and chain, new water distribution tube if yours is corroded. Valves and seats can be reused depending on condition, freeze plugs need to be replaced after boiling out the block. New valve guides.. Might want to get a new oil pump but I reused mine. Water pump, new h9ses and belts, new thermostat. Some folks get new heabolts some clean up and reuse the old ones.. if you choose new,, keep the ones that have the threaded heads.they come in handy. New spark plugs wires and tune up stiff for the distributor number on the dist data plate starts with three letters. Look at what is available from different sources. Egge for rings and pistons, vintage power wagons, Terrell machine parts for internal parts, Robert's motor parts, Andy burnbaum. And a couple others. Money can be saved by shopping different sources rather than getting a kit from one vendor.

  17. So are your lights fairly new or have the been there 10 or 15 years. Are your lights properly grounded? P15 headlights ground to an area that gets all the crap the tires throw up. Is your sheet metal there in good shape to provide a good ground? Is your cars body grounded by a dedicated ground strap to the frame or engine? Or you counting on body mounts bolts that have been there for 80 years? Doctor Ohm says 40 watts is 40 watts whether it's 12v or 6 volts. Switch or wires and connections in good shape? Would relays help?
  18. Make a separate dedicated wire from one of rhe mounting screws to a known good ground. Also squish the socket a bit oval with pliers so the bulb is tightysecured in the socket. And if your bulbs don't have the offset mount pins, make sure the brighter element is indexed to the signal and the dim one aligned to park. The dim element doesn't have enough resistance to trigger the flasher. It will light up but not flash.

  20. Do first and reverse grind a bit going into gear from neutral while stopped, or does second grind a little when downshifting? Try this, before shifting into first or reverse, momentarily select second with the clutch pedal at the floor. If grinding is less or goes away this indicates the clutch is not completely stopping in neutral at idle. When you try to select second, the synchro pack stops the clutch from turning the input shaft which decreases the likely hood of gringing. Your clutch rod that pushes the throw out fork needs to be adjusted so it's longer and pushes the throw out farther so the friction disc stops spinning completely. This will lessen the grinding selecting first and reverse at rest, will allow the synchro to stop the input shaft on the upshift from low to second and second to third and will also help on the high to second down shift. The clutch rod is easily adjusted with a couple wrenches. On a further note, I have discovered with that when the overdrive is engaged, and is in freewheeling mode under 30 mph, low gear can be engaged under 15 mph or so with very little grinding. Another perq of running the overdrive unit.
  21. Talking about axle bearings and grease, you should find small plugs screwed into the outer axle ends. People are tempted to put zerk fittings in these and add grease with a pressure gun. DONT DO IT! While these plugs are meant to feed grease, the grease is meant to be thumbed in on an occasional basis. The gun will bypass the seal introducing axle grease onto the backing plates. Note also the splitter fitting for the rear brake fluid lines contains a ventilator to relieve heat pressure in the differential. If the vent gets plugged, the pressure can also defeat the axle seals.
